Common Issues and Errors Related to VoiceAccessUserInterface.dll
Although essential for system performance, dynamic Link Library (DLL) files can occasionally cause specific errors. The following enumerates some of the most common DLL errors users encounter while operating their systems:
- The file VoiceAccessUserInterface.dll is missing: The specified DLL file couldn't be found. It may have been unintentionally deleted or moved from its original location.
- VoiceAccessUserInterface.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error typically signifies that the DLL file may be incompatible with your version of Windows, or it's corrupted. It can also occur if you're trying to run a DLL file meant for a different system architecture (for instance, a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system).
- VoiceAccessUserInterface.dll not found: This indicates that the application you're trying to run is looking for a specific DLL file that it can't locate. This could be due to the DLL file being missing, corrupted, or incorrectly installed.
- This application failed to start because VoiceAccessUserInterface.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error message is a sign that a DLL file that the application relies on is not present in the system. Reinstalling the application may install the missing DLL file and fix the problem.
- VoiceAccessUserInterface.dll Access Violation: This points to a situation where a process has attempted to interact with VoiceAccessUserInterface.dll in a way that violates system or application rules. This might be due to incorrect programming, memory overflows, or the running process lacking necessary permissions.

Perform a Clean Boot
How to perform a clean boot. This can isolate the issue with VoiceAccessUserInterface.dll and help resolve the problem.
-
In the General tab, select Selective startup.
-
Uncheck Load startup items.
-
Go to the Services tab.
-
Check Hide all Microsoft services.
-
Click Disable all.
-
Open Task Manager.
-
Go to the Startup tab.
-
Disable all the startup programs.
